Gangajhola Population - Ganjam, Orissa

Gangajhola is a medium size village located in TARASINGI Block of Ganjam district, Orissa with total 113 families residing. The Gangajhola village has population of 489 of which 236 are males while 253 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Gangajhola village population of children with age 0-6 is 62 which makes up 12.68 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Gangajhola village is 1072 which is higher than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Gangajhola as per census is 1583, higher than Orissa average of 941.

Gangajhola village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Gangajhola village was 65.81 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Gangajhola Male literacy stands at 71.70 % while female literacy rate was 60.00 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 16.36 % of total population in Gangajhola village. The village Gangajhola curr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Gangajhola village out of total population, 135 were engaged in work activities. 94.81 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 5.19 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 135 workers engaged in Main Work, 39 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 26 were Agricultural labourer.
